What is Meta Sales?

Meta Sales refers to sales roles within Meta, the parent company of Facebook, Instagram, WhatsApp, and other products. Professionals in Meta Sales focus on helping businesses leverage Meta’s advertising and marketing solutions to reach their target audiences and achieve their business objectives. They work with clients to develop effective ad strategies, optimize campaigns, and analyze performance. Meta Sales roles require strong communication, analytical skills, and a deep understanding of digital marketing trends.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Meta Sales professional?

To thrive as a Meta Sales professional, you need expertise in digital advertising, strong analytical skills, and a deep understanding of Meta’s advertising platforms, often supported by a relevant degree and sales experience. Familiarity with Meta Business Suite, Ads Manager, CRM tools, and certifications like Meta Certified Digital Marketing Associate are typically required. Excellent communication, relationship-building, and problem-solving abilities help differentiate top performers in this field. These skills are crucial for driving successful client campaigns, achieving sales targets, and adapting to the fast-changing digital advertising landscape.

How does a Meta Sales professional typ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to achieve client goals?

Meta Sales professionals work closely with account managers, marketing strategists, product specialists, and data analysts to design and implement advertising solutions that meet client objectives. Regular meetings and strategy sessions help ensure alignment on campaign goals, creative direction, and performance metrics. Effective collaboration is crucial, as Meta Sales team members often act as a bridge between clients and internal teams to address challenges, optimize campaigns, and deliver measurable results. This collaborative environment supports professional growth and innovation.

Job description

We’re looking for a Director of Sales & Marketing to lead and execute sales & marketing strategies across our hotel group. This person will drive revenue growth by capturing corporate, group, and LNR (Local Negotiated Rate) business across key markets, and be responsible for generating revenue through corporate sales, executing effective marketing campaigns, ensuring a strong digital presence, and coordinating with marketing partners to maintain brand strength and visibility.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Sales Leadership

  • Act as the face of GreenTree in your region — building and nurturing relationships with new and existing clients through proactive sales calls, networking, and referrals.
  • Travel locally and regionally as necessary to conduct outside sales, attend trade shows and deliver presentations to promote hotels and develop new business.
  • Develop and implement sales strategies to attract and grow corporate accounts, groups, and travel agency business.
  • Identify and pursue new B2B opportunities across industries and regions aligned with each property’s profile.
  • Conduct competitor analysis and identify market trends.
  • Develop targeted sales and marketing plans that drive revenue and increase market share.
  • Conduct sales blitzes in coordination with GMs to drive outreach and visibility within local markets.
  • Train General Managers (GMs) and Front Desk (FD) staff on sales tactics to ensure alignment and maximize revenue at the property level.
  • Maintain accurate information in sales management tool (STS) on all new and ongoing leads and accounts, including solicitation efforts and all activities are complete and documented.
  • Work with General Managers to ensure clients’ needs are executed perfectly to build lasting relationships and opportunities
  • Craft, present, and negotiate sales contracts with corporate clients, agencies, and group partners.
  • Lead the end-to-end RFP process, including proposal development, pricing strategy, and account follow-up.
  • Participate in revenue management calls to align sales strategy with pricing, demand forecasts, and performance trends.
  • Participate in budgeting and forecasting on monthly and yearly level.

Marketing, Website & Campaign Management

  • Design and execute digital marketing campaigns, including email campaigns, promotional offers, and seasonal marketing initiatives.
  • Write, design (with agency support), and schedule regular e-newsletters to engage B2B and B2C customer segments.
  • Manage Meta (Facebook/Instagram) ad campaigns and track ROI.
  • Develop promotional content (ads, landing pages, social content).
  • Coordinate photo/video shoots for marketing use, ensuring all creative assets align with brand standards.
  • Ensure hotel websites are updated regularly with offers, events, and property information, while applying SEO best practices.
  • Partner with marketing vendors or internal teams to improve site performance and search visibility.

CRM & Loyalty Program Management

  • Serve as the lead owner of the CRM platform, ensuring data integrity, segmentation accuracy, and system optimization.
  • Collaborate with marketing vendors to enhance CRM functionality and integrations.
  • Oversee the hotel group’s loyalty program, ensuring smooth operations, reward fulfillment, and consistent member communication.
  • Analyze performance metrics for loyalty engagement and recommend improvements to increase sign-ups and repeat stays.

Analytics & Reporting

  • Analyze the effectiveness of marketing campaigns and report on KPIs to executive leadership.
  • Maintain and update a CRM database to track corporate clients, campaigns, and conversion metrics.
  • Provide monthly sales and marketing performance reports and strategic recommendations.

Job Qualifications

  • Knowledge of local competition and industry trends
  • Strong leadership and a polished, professional presence
  • Excellent decision making ability and analytical skills
  • Strong understanding of SEO, digital media, and email campaign best practices.
  • Excellent communication skills and attention to detail; highly organized and results-oriented.
  • Knowledge in Microsoft Office suite, outlook, and other hotel-related systems
  • Be able to multi-task various job duties daily
  • Ability to travel and work flexible schedules, including weekends and holidays
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ent education/experience

ABOUT GREENTREE HOSPITALITY GROUP:

GreenTree Hospitality Group (GHG) is a leading owner, operator, and franchiser of 5,000+ hotels worldwide. Ranked by Hotel Magazine 2020 as the 13th largest hotel company in the world, GHG is a trusted partner for its franchisees, employees, and guests alike. GreenTree Hospitality Group USA is an affiliated company of GHG based in Scottsdale, Arizona. Brands include GreenTree Inn, GreenTree Inn & Suites, GreenTree Extended Stay, GreenTree Hotel, and GreenTree Boutique Collection. GreenTree prides itself on being able to deliver the ultimate, value-driven, and eco-friendly lodging experience.
